Jakarta. BMW has been awarded a total of nine accolades from three
local automobile magazines, Auto Bild Indonesia, MobilMotor and Top
Gear Indonesia, in September 2005, reflecting the company's outstanding
record of performance and quality. The Auto Bild Indonesia Award 2005
honored BMW with 4 awards. The new BMW 7 Series clinched the award for
the "Big Luxury Car", the new BMW 5 Series earned the title
of "Best in Medium Luxury Sedan", the new BMW 3 Series headed
the "Small Luxury Car" category, while the BMW X3 won the
"Best in Big SUV" garland. The awards were presented by the
Chief Editor of Auto Bild Indonesia to Josef Honsel, President Director
of BMW Indonesia, on September 29, 2005. At the same time, MobilMotor
awarded BMW with 3 awards in the Indonesian Car of the Year competition
and winning in every categories of its class. The new BMW 325i has
outstripped the field to become the "Best Premium Sedan",
while in the category of "Best Exclusive Sedan", BMW 530i won
the award. In addition, MobilMotor hailed the new BMW 120i as the
"Best Hatchback Sedan". The accolade was presented by the
Chief Editor of MobilMotor to Josef Honsel, President Director of BMW
Indonesia on September 28, 2005. The 4th annual Top Gear Best Choice
2005 competition also saw BMW garner two awards. The new BMW 3 Series
won the "Best Executive" category by unanimous vote of the
judges who were drawn from the ranks of the journalists themselves.
"This is the most visually-pleasing design from the latest
generation of 3 series," said Top Gear's chief editor at the
presentation of the awards on September 1, 2005. Winning the
"Best Sports Coupe" category was the BMW 645 Ci, according to
Top Gear, this is a genuine grand tourer which gives sheer driving
pleasure, character and sportiness. "These nine awards, which
came in quick succession, represent a significant milestone for BMW
Indonesia, as its leadership in producing exceptional cars and
delivering high quality services has been reaffirmed by the industry and
our customers," remarked Josef Honsel. BMW in Indonesia PT
BMW Indonesia is a wholly owned subsidiary of Bayerische Motoren Werke
(BMW) AG, the world manufacturer of BMW vehicles based in Munich,
Germany. The establishment of this subsidiary in April 2001 reflects
the BMW Group's confidence in the long-term future of Indonesia and its
commitment to maintaining and extending BMW's leading position in the
premium market segment. PT BMW Indonesia's activities cover the
wholesale of BMW cars, spare parts and accessories, as well as the
overall planning of sales, marketing, after-sales, and related
activities in Indonesia. Its dealership network covers 15 dealers with
18 outlets spread out in various cities in Indonesia. More information
